In this podcast Shane Hastie, InfoQ Lead Editor for Culture & Methods, spoke to Jason Hand of VictorOps about the DevOps culture, what ChatOps is and powerful post-mortems.
Why listen to this podcast:
- The misaligned incentives between development and operations in many organisations
- The need to instil a sense of ownership across the whole delivery organisation where everyone takes responsibility for solving problems, rather than saying “that’s not my job”
- There is no roadmap to change the culture of a company, because every company is different
- In complex systems you can’t avoid failure, so make sure you can learn from it and respond rapidly
